Methylphenidate, {commonly known as Ritalin or Concerta|frequently recognized as Ritalin or Concerta, is a central nervous system stimulant drug. While its primary application is in the treatment of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D), it also has applications in treating narcolepsy and certain other brain disorders. Ritalin Prescription Rates Across European Nations
Prescribing patterns for Ritalin, a medication primarily used to treat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D), display significant variation across European nations. Some countries, such as UK, tend to dispense Ritalin at higher rates compared to others, like France. This gap can be attributed to a blend of factors, including cultural attitudes towards ADHD, access to healthcare, and diverse assessment methods.
The supply of Ritalin can also be influenced by policies implemented at the national level. Some countries may have tighter restrictions on the prescription and dispensing of ADHD medications, while others may have a more lenient approach. These differences in access to Ritalin can have profound implications for individuals with ADHD and their overall health.

The Role of Pharmacies in Dispensing Ritalin Across Europe
Prescriptions for att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) medication like Ritalin are growing across Europe. As a result, pharmacies play a central role in dispensing these medications to patients, ensuring safe and lawful access. However, the supervision of Ritalin distribution varies widely across European countries, leading to variations in practice and potential concerns about misuse or misappropriation.
Furthermore, pharmacists often serve as a crucial source of information for patients regarding the proper use and potential side effects of Ritalin. They educate patients on the importance of adherence to their prescribed medication regimen and can track any adverse reactions. This active approach by pharmacists supports to optimize patient outcomes and minimize potential risks associated with Ritalin use.
